COMPLETE RESULTS FROM THE FINAL RESOLUTION PAY-PER-VIEW EVENT:
- In the controversial "Feast Or Fired" match, the four briefcases were claimed by the following superstars:
Hernandez of the Latin American Xchange
Homicide of the Latin American Xchange
Curry Man
"Black Machismo" Jay Lethal
Lethal's briefcase was opened following the bout, revealing he has earned a shot at the TNA World Tag Team Championship. Alex Shelley disputed Lethal's ownership of the briefcase, as Lethal grabbed it from Shelley before he could exit the ring with it!
- ODB, Roxxi and Taylor Wilide beat The Beautiful People and Sharmell when Wilde got the win on Angelina Love
- Thanks to an assist by referee Shane Sewell, Eric Young beat Sheik Abdul Bashir to win the X Division Championship. After the bout, a enraged Bashir bloodied the referee. However, TNA Management Director Jim Cornette came out and took the title from Bashir and refused to give it back!
- Christy Hemme beat TNA Knockout Women's Champion Awesome Kong by disqualification after Kong's manager Raisha Saeed got involved
- Beer Money Inc ("Cowboy" James Storm and Robert Roode) retained the TNA World Tag Team Championship over Abyss and "The Blueprint" Matt Morgan when Storm used what looked to be a pair of brass knuckles on Abyss to get the pin.
- The Motor City Machineguns asked Mick Foley to overturn the decision from the Feast or Fired match, which would give them Lethal's Tag Team Title shot. However, when Shelley and Sabin went to the ring to wait on Foley's decision, TNA newcomer Suicide made his surprise debut and attacked the Machineguns!
- Olympic gold medalist Kurt Angle defeated "The War Machine" Rhino (with Mick Foley serving as special enforcer) after Al Snow made a surprise appearance to distract Mick Foley! With Foley's back turned, Angle nailed Rhino with a chair and hit the Olympic Slam to get the pin. Afterwards, Angle told Foley he's demanding his rematch with Jarrett at "Genesis", and he's coming to kick Foley's ass after he's done with Jarrett!
- The Main Event Mafia defeated TNA Frontline in the featured bout, with Sting's TNA World Heavyweight Championship on the line. Samoa Joe was on the verge of defeating Sting when Kevin Nash interfered and hit Joe with a low blow, allowing Sting to hit the Scorpion Deathdrop for the win!
